§ 70.30 GENERAL PARKING REGULATIONS.
   It is unlawful for any person, as driver or operator of a vehicle or as the registered owner of a vehicle, to park, stop or leave standing, or cause, allow or permit to be parked, stopped or left standing, whether knowingly or unknowingly, any vehicle in any of the following places:
   (A)   Upon a public sidewalk;
   (B)   Upon any public street within four feet of the radius point, taper point or the point on a curb or curb line at which the curb or curb line becomes part of a public or private curb cut of a driveway or between two points with respect to a given curb cut or driveway;
   (C)   Upon any public street within any intersection;
   (D)   Upon any public street within ten feet of any fire hydrant;
   (E)   Upon any public street on any crosswalk;
   (F)   Upon any public street within twenty (10) feet of a crosswalk at any intersection or within 30 feet of any intersection at which there is no crosswalk;
   (G)   Upon any public street within 15 feet upon the approach to any flashing beacon, stop light or traffic-control signal located at the side of the roadway;
   (H)   Upon any public street within 20 feet of the driveway entrance to any fire station and on the side of a street opposite the entrance to any fire station within 75 feet of the entrance when the restriction is properly signed;
   (I)   Upon any public street alongside or opposite any street excavation or obstruction when the stopping, standing or parking may obstruct traffic;
   (J)   Upon any public street on the roadway side of any vehicle stopped or parked upon the street;
   (K)   Upon any public street at any place where official signs prohibit parking, standing or stopping;
   (L)   On any part of front yard, rear yard and side yard, except on a hard surfaced parking space;
   (M)   Parking in city parks and recreation areas will be limited to designated areas; the areas will be clearly marked. Parking is prohibited in any other area of the parks and recreational areas. No person will be allowed to park in any area designated for handicapped purposes other than those who have been issued a handicapped parking permit or license as issued by the state. No vehicle will be allowed to park in any area designated as authorized vehicles only besides city vehicles; and/or
   (N)   Any other areas so designated by resolution of the City Council.
